«unix» etiketlenmiş sorular

Bu etiket, doğrudan Unix ile ilişkili PROGRAMLAMA soruları için özeldir; genel yazılım sorunları Unix ve Linux Stack Exchange sitesine veya Süper Kullanıcıya yönlendirilmelidir. Unix işletim sistemi Bell Labs tarafından 1960'ların sonlarında geliştirilen ve bugün çeşitli versiyonlarda bulunan genel amaçlı bir işletim sistemidir.

8
Bash'de iki değişkeni çıkarın
İki dizin arasındaki dosya sayısını çıkarmak için aşağıdaki komut dosyası var ama COUNT=ifade çalışmıyor. Doğru sözdizimi nedir? #!/usr/bin/env bash FIRSTV=`ls -1 | wc -l` cd .. SECONDV=`ls -1 | wc -l` COUNT=expr $FIRSTV-$SECONDV ## -> gives 'command not found' error echo $COUNT
220 bash  shell  unix 


11
C fopen vs açık
Kullanmak istediğiniz herhangi bir neden var mı (sözdizimsel olanlar dışında) FILE *fdopen(int fd, const char *mode); veya FILE *fopen(const char *path, const char *mode); onun yerine int open(const char *pathname, int flags, mode_t mode); Linux ortamında C kullanırken?
219 c  linux  unix  file-io  fopen 



4
Osx üzerindeki .so ve .dylib arasındaki farklar nelerdir?
.dylib, OSX'teki dinamik kitaplık uzantısıdır, ancak geleneksel bir unix .so paylaşılan nesnesini kullanamadığım / kullanamadığım zaman hiçbir zaman net değildi. Sorularımdan bazıları: Kavramsal düzeyde, .so ve .dylib arasındaki temel farklar nelerdir? Birini diğeri ne zaman kullanabilir / kullanmalıyım? Derleme hileleri ve ipuçları (Örneğin, osc üzerinde çalışmadığı için gcc -shared -fPIC'in …
214 c++  c  macos  unix 

4
Verileri bir dosyanın ikinci sütununa göre sıralama
İki sütun ve nsatır sayısı bir dosya var . sütun 1 içerir namesve sütun2 age. Bu dosyanın içeriğini age(ikinci sütunda) göre artan sırada sıralamak istiyorum . Sonuç name, en genç kişiyi nameve daha sonra ikinci en genç kişiyi göstermelidir ... Bir astar kabuğu veya bash betiği için herhangi bir öneri.
212 bash  shell  unix 


24
Ebeveyn çıktıktan sonra çocuk süreci nasıl ölür?
Bir çocuk sürecini ortaya çıkaran bir sürecim olduğunu varsayalım. Şimdi ana süreç herhangi bir nedenle (normalde veya anormal olarak, kill, ^ C, iddia hatası veya başka bir şeyle) çıktığında, alt sürecin ölmesini istiyorum. Bunu nasıl doğru şekilde yapabilirim? Stackoverflow hakkında benzer bir soru: (daha önce soruldu) Ebeveyn yaptığında alt işlemden …
209 c  linux  unix  process  fork 

18
Bir dosyanın ortasında belirli satırları görüntülemek için hızlı unix komutu?
Bir sunucuyla ilgili bir sorunu ayıklamaya çalışmak ve tek günlük dosyam 20GB günlük dosyasıdır (zaman damgası bile olmadan! İnsanlar neden System.out.println()günlük olarak kullanır ? Üretimde ?!) Grep kullanarak, dosyanın 347340107 satırına bakmak istediğim bir alanını buldum. Gibi bir şey yapmaktan başka head -<$LINENUM + 10> filename | tail -20 ... …
206 linux  bash  unix  text 






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.